The Dorogomilovsky Court of Moscow seized property worth over 533.6 million rubles from the former Deputy Interior Minister of Dagestan, Rufat Ismailov, and four other defendants. This was announced on April 2 by a correspondent of Izvestia from the courtroom.

During the meeting, the defendants and their representatives opposed the satisfaction of the claim, referring to the legality of the acquisition of property. They also claimed that some of the objects were bought on credit.

In turn, the prosecutor drew attention to Ismailov's lifestyle. He recalled that a large number of luxury items were found and seized from the former deputy Interior Minister of Dagestan, which does not correspond to information about his earnings. Ismailov himself participated in the meeting from the pre-trial detention center via video link.

Ismailov was detained on November 7, 2023, and a criminal case was opened against him on the same day for receiving and paying a particularly large bribe. The next day, a correspondent of Izvestia, broadcasting from the hall of the Basmanny court in Moscow, announced the arrest of the defendant.
